Approx 1.75 KM away
Address: 5th Street, Talomo District, Davao City, Davao del Sur, Philippines
Approx 1.76 KM away
Address: Lanang Aplaya, Davao City, 8000 Davao del Sur, Philippines
Approx 1.81 KM away
Address: Matina Crossing, Talomo District, Davao City, Davao del Sur, Philippines